nf-core/ampliseq version 2.14.0 - 2025-05-23 Summary of changes Multi-region analysis is now easier with custom databases, parameters were changed or added Updated sbdi-gtdb, gtdb, PR2 databases and added BOLD plant databases for classification with DADA2 Follow nextflow's strict syntax (only impacts development) Detailed changes Added #879 - Add sbdi-gtdb=R10-RS226-1 as parameter to --dada_ref_taxonomy and make this version the default for sbdi-gtdb. #882 - Add gtdb=R10-RS226 as parameter to --dada_ref_taxonomy and make this version the default for gtdb. #883 - Add BOLD databases plantae-bold-its1 & plantae-bold-trnL, for plant samples with markers ITS1 and trnL, versions 20240510, for DADA2 as parameter to --dada2_ref_taxonomy. #885 - Add pr2=5.1.0 as parameter to --dada_ref_taxonomy and make this version the default for pr2. Changed #871 - Multi-region analysis is now easier with custom databases. No alignment file of the reference sequences are needed. | Parameter | Description | | ------------------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| | sidle_ref_tax_custom | Changed: Previously three files, now one file: path to reference taxonomy strings | | sidle_ref_seq_custom | New: Path to reference taxonomy sequences in fasta format | | sidle_ref_aln_custom | New: Path to multiple sequence alignment of reference taxonomy sequences in fasta format | | sidle_ref_degenerates | New: Only effective with --sidle_ref_tax_custom, filter reference sequences, default: 5 | | sidle_ref_cleaning | New: Arguments regarding ad-hoc cleaning, with --sidle_ref_tax_custom default is '--p-database silva' | Fixed #872 - Follow nextflow's strict syntax #876 - Pulled the updated vsearch/clusters module from nf-core to fix a bug where a wildcard expansion trigging an arguments-too-long error. #878 - Downgraded nf-schema from 2.3.0 to 2.2.0 due to incompatibilities with nextflow stable versions 25.05 and newer #881 - Template update for nf-core/tools version 3.2.1 #887 - Updated documentation to include all updates
